Abstract
X-ray diffraction, magnetic susceptibility measurements and 119Sn Mössbauer spectroscopy were used to study the intermetallic DyAuSn and DyAgSn compounds. It was shown that both compounds order antiferromagnetically at low temperatures. The Dy magnetic moments are normal to the hexagonal c-axis in DyAuSn and are inclined at an angle of 45° to this axis in DyAgSn. The occurrence of a magnetic hyperfine field distribution in DyAgSn suggests that this compound crystallizes in the disordered CaIn2-type of structure.
